Title:
  nvidia driver - does not resume from suspend

Status in gnome-control-center package in Ubuntu:
  New

Bug description:
  The same as always:
  System gets to sleep (systemctl suspend), when pressing a key to resume from 
sleep, the system will power up (fans and hard disk can be heard), but screens 
remain dark. Not even terminals can be accessed (ctrl-alt-F2...6).
  No problem with nouveau driver this time...

  ubuntu GNOME 18.04, clean install
  Fujitsu-Siemens Celsius WT-380
  nvidia GT 630
  two monitors - MY GUESS IS THAT THIS IS IS AN IMPORTANT ASPECT

  Tried nvidia340, 390 and 396 - all the same result.
